Why Your Budget Feels Different After True Preapproval

A quick online estimate can feel helpful, but it usually leaves out the real story. It may not fully consider your income details, credit profile, or other monthly debts. It also rarely asks about your future plans, which matter a lot more than many people think.

A true, strategy-driven mortgage preapproval in Elmhurst, IL looks deeper. We walk through things like:

• Income sources and how steady they are  

• Credit history and how it could affect pricing and options  

• Monthly debts, including cars, cards, and student loans  

• Savings habits and how much you want to keep as a cushion  

Then we line that up with realistic housing costs for Elmhurst and nearby communities like Wheaton, Naperville, and Geneva. That means not just the principal and interest, but also property taxes, homeowner’s insurance, and any possible HOA dues. Once all that is in the picture, your “comfortable” payment range usually looks more specific, and more helpful, than a simple estimate.

How Elmhurst Preapproval Shapes Neighborhood Choices

Once you have a clear preapproval, the way you look at neighborhoods starts to change. You are no longer just scrolling for pretty kitchens. You are asking, “Does this area fit our safe monthly payment and our daily routine?”

Different suburbs and even different blocks can carry very different property tax levels. Those tax amounts feed straight into your monthly housing cost and can shift what makes sense for you. A home at the same price in Elmhurst, Wheaton, Naperville, or Geneva may lead to very different payments once taxes and fees are added.

A thoughtful preapproval looks beyond the sticker price and helps you compare:

• Areas with higher taxes but shorter commutes or better walkability  

• Older homes that might have higher utility costs or upcoming repairs  

• Newer homes that may cost more upfront but offer better energy efficiency  

• Places with HOAs that add a fee but cover certain services  

When the numbers are clear, you and your real estate professional can quickly filter listings. You skip the emotional whiplash of touring homes that were never going to be a strong long‑term fit. Instead, you can focus on what truly matters to you, like yard size, parks, school zones, or how close you want to be to downtown Elmhurst and Metra.

Tailoring Mortgage Options to Your Elmhurst Life Plans

The best preapproval does not start with a rate; it starts with your life. How long do you plan to stay in the home? Could your job change? Are you planning a family, or thinking about helping kids with college later on? These kinds of plans shape what type of loan structure may fit you best.

Different program choices can change which Elmhurst homes and price points feel smart:

• Fixed-rate options for long-term stability  

• Adjustable-rate choices for buyers who may move sooner  

• Shorter terms that focus on faster payoff  

• Lower-down-payment solutions that keep more cash in the bank  

We look at how each option lines up with your goals. Maybe you want to keep flexibility to refinance later, or you like the idea of paying off the home faster once other debts are gone. Maybe freeing up cash for remodeling or future investments matters more than a slightly lower payment today.
